Pressure Laundering Wood Surfaces



When stress washing wood surface areas, it's critical to choose the best equipment and strategy to avoid damages. Beginning by picking a stress washer with adjustable settings. Before you begin, make sure to clear the location of furniture, plants, and various other challenges. It's vital to examine a little, unnoticeable area first to guarantee your strategy and pressure settings won't harm the surface area.

Use a fan nozzle attachment for an even circulation of water. Hold the nozzle at a 45-degree angle and a minimum of 12 inches far from the wood to minimize the risk of damages.

As you clean, move in long, sweeping activities along the grain of the wood. This technique assists lift dust and particles successfully without leaving streaks.

After washing, rinse the surface area thoroughly to get rid of any continuing to be cleaning option. Permit the wood to completely dry completely prior to using any type of sealer or tarnish. Adhering to these actions will certainly ensure your wood surface areas remain in excellent problem while looking fresh and clean.

Techniques for Cleansing Concrete



Concrete surfaces can build up dirt, crud, and stains gradually, making efficient cleaning methods vital. This degree of stress successfully eliminates persistent spots without damaging the surface area.

Prior to you start, spray the area with a concrete cleaner or a mix of cleaning agent and water. Enable it to stay for regarding 10-15 mins; this aids break down hard spots.

Next off, connect a broad spray nozzle to your pressure washer, ideally a 25-degree or 40-degree pointer. This will certainly distribute the water equally and lessen the danger of etching.



When you start pressure washing, operate in sections. Keep the nozzle about 12 inches from the surface area and preserve a consistent, sweeping activity. This strategy guarantees you do not miss any areas or use too much stress in one location.

For specifically stubborn spots, you may need to repeat the process or use a much more focused cleaner.

Ultimately, rinse the location thoroughly after cleaning. This step protects against any type of residue from staying on the concrete, leaving it tidy and looking fresh.

Best Practices for Vinyl House Siding



Vinyl siding is a prominent option for home owners as a result of its longevity and low upkeep needs. Nonetheless, to keep it looking its best, you'll require to push clean it periodically.

Begin by preparing the location-- eliminate any furnishings, plants, or challenges near your home. Next, select a stress washing machine with a nozzle that delivers a broad spray; generally, a 25-degree nozzle functions well.

Prior to you begin, examine a small section to guarantee your settings will not damage the siding. Keep the stress below 2000 PSI to prevent any dents or cracks. Start from all-time low and function your means up, cleaning in areas to stop streaks.

Use a detergent especially created for plastic siding to help eliminate dirt and mold and mildew. Apply it with your pressure washing machine or a pump sprayer, allowing it to sit for around 10 mins.

Afterward, rinse completely from the top down, making certain all detergent is eliminated. Finally, examine the house siding for any missed out on areas or stubborn stains that might need additional interest.

Routine upkeep will keep your plastic siding looking fresh and prolong its life-span, making it a rewarding investment for your home.
